VOUCHERS and prizes are to be won as part of a special scarecrow making competition launched in Gillingham.
Residents are being challenged to make a scarecrow using household materials and items, which can then be displayed in front of their home for passers-by to enjoy.
Prizes will be awarded to the best and most creative designs, with first, second and third places up for grabs.
The prizes for first place have been titled ‘Family Night In’, offering a £30 voucher for Gillingham Tandoori, half a case of wine from Yapp Brothers and a £25 voucher for Waitrose.
Entry costs £5, with money raised going to the charity Friends of Wyke.
Details about payment and the Just Giving page will be released shortly.
To enter, email a photo of the scarecrow by June 8 to office@gillinghamwyke.dorset.sch.uk
